Softball Preview: Springboro Panthers vs. Springfield Wildcats

Springboro has enjoyed the comforts of home their last four games, but now they'll head out on the road. They will face off against the Springfield Wildcats at 5:00 p.m. on Friday. Springboro is strutting in with some hitting muscle, as they've averaged 6.1 runs per game this season.

Last Wednesday, everything went Springboro's way against Springfield as Springboro made off with a 12-2 victory.

Kinley Johnson looked comfortable as she didn't allow a single earned run and only one hit over four innings pitched. She has been nothing but reliable on the mound: she hasn't given up more than two hits in four consecutive pitching appearances.

On the hitting side, Springboro got a massive performance out of Bri Schul, who went 3-for-4 with two runs, a triple, and a double. Another player making a difference was Hannah Gardner, who went 1-for-4 with a home run and three RBI.

The win got Springboro back to even at 5-5. As for Springfield, they have traveled a rocky road recently having lost six of their last eight matchups, which put a noticeable dent in their 4-8 record this season.
